Board approves $138,953 contract to rebuild Warren Miller Park restrooms
Summary
The board awarded a $138,953 contract to Fredericks for reconstruction of Warren Miller Park restrooms, accepting staff’s recommendation that Fredericks was the lowest and most responsive bidder.

Community Development staff asked the Anderson City Board of Public Works on Nov. 4 to approve a contract to reconstruct the public restrooms at Warren Miller Park and identified Fredericks as the lowest and most responsive bidder.
"They were the lowest and most responsive," Community Development staff said when presenting the bid tabulation. The staff request specified a contract amount of $138,953. Board member (Speaker 2) moved to award the contract to Fredericks as requested; the Chair seconded and the board approved the award by voice vote.
The motion approves the contract award as presented; staff did not provide further breakdown of funding sources or a construction schedule during the meeting. The board’s vote completes the local approval step needed for the department to proceed with contracting.
